Gisele Pelicot's daughter has revealed her thoughts on chemical castration, and said it could be a 'solution' for rapists like her father.

Caroline Darian's 72-year-old mother Gisele was drugged and mercilessly raped by husband Dominique Pelicot and dozens of men over a period of nine years.

In December, 51 men were finally convicted in the lengthy drugging-and-rape trial that riveted France.

Now, speaking to Sky's The Politics Hub in an emotional interview, Caroline told correspondent Ali Fortescue that the UK government's plans to consider mandatory chemical castration for sex offenders could be 'part of the solution.'

'For my dad, its probably one part of the solution, because, you know, when you're at that level of crime...there's nothing else you can do.
